The penetration testing market, valued at $1727.6 million in 2025, is experiencing robust growth, projected to expand at a compound annual growth rate (CAGR) of 20.5% from 2025 to 2033. This surge is driven by the increasing frequency and sophistication of cyberattacks targeting businesses and organizations of all sizes. The rising adoption of cloud computing and the expanding attack surface created by the Internet of Things (IoT) are significant contributing factors. Furthermore, stringent regulatory compliance requirements, such as GDPR and CCPA, necessitate robust penetration testing programs to ensure data security and avoid hefty penalties. Leading players like Synopsys (Cigital), Acunetix, Checkmarx, and Qualys are actively innovating and expanding their offerings to meet the growing demand, further fueling market expansion. The market is segmented by testing type (e.g., network, application, wireless), deployment model (cloud-based, on-premises), organization size, and industry vertical. Each segment demonstrates varying growth rates reflecting specific industry needs and adoption trends.
The forecast period, 2025-2033, anticipates significant market expansion. Increased investment in cybersecurity infrastructure and a growing awareness of vulnerabilities among businesses will drive demand for penetration testing services. However, challenges such as skill shortages in cybersecurity professionals and the high cost associated with comprehensive penetration testing might act as restraints on market growth. Nevertheless, the ongoing evolution of cyber threats and increasing regulatory pressure are expected to outweigh these challenges, ensuring consistent market growth throughout the forecast period. Geographical expansion, particularly in emerging economies with rapidly developing digital infrastructures, also presents considerable opportunities for market players.

Key market insights indicate a shift towards more comprehensive and automated penetration testing solutions, driven by the need for faster, more efficient vulnerability assessments. Organizations are increasingly adopting continuous penetration testing methodologies to proactively identify and mitigate risks in real-time, rather than relying on infrequent, sporadic audits. The rise of cloud computing and the Internet of Things (IoT) has also significantly expanded the attack surface, creating a heightened demand for specialized penetration testing services that address the unique security challenges presented by these technologies. This trend is further amplified by stringent regulatory compliance mandates, compelling organizations to invest heavily in robust security postures, including regular penetration testing. The market is witnessing a significant increase in demand for penetration testing services from small and medium-sized enterprises (SMEs), who are increasingly recognizing the importance of proactive security measures to protect their critical data and systems. Finally, the growing adoption of DevSecOps practices is promoting the integration of penetration testing into the software development lifecycle, ensuring security is built into applications from the outset, rather than being an afterthought. Despite the burgeoning market, challenges persist. The shortage of skilled penetration testers is a significant hurdle, leading to higher costs and longer testing times. The complexity of modern IT infrastructures, particularly cloud-based environments and IoT devices, makes comprehensive testing increasingly difficult and resource-intensive. Maintaining up-to-date knowledge of evolving attack techniques and exploiting zero-day vulnerabilities requires continuous training and investment in skilled professionals, a cost that can be prohibitive for some organizations. Additionally, false positives and the difficulty in accurately assessing the criticality of identified vulnerabilities can lead to inefficient allocation of resources and potentially missed critical security threats. The need for tailored penetration testing solutions that address the specific vulnerabilities of different industries and organizational structures adds another layer of complexity and cost. Finally, balancing the need for comprehensive security with the potential disruption of business operations during penetration testing poses a constant challenge for organizations. These combined challenges can impact the adoption rate and efficiency of penetration testing, especially for smaller organizations with limited budgets and resources.
The penetration testing market exhibits significant regional variations. North America is currently a dominant force, due to the high concentration of technologically advanced businesses and a strong regulatory framework emphasizing robust cybersecurity. However, the Asia-Pacific region is projected to experience substantial growth in the coming years, driven by rapid economic development, increasing digitalization, and a rising awareness of cybersecurity risks. Europe is also expected to contribute significantly, propelled by stringent data privacy regulations (GDPR) and increasing adoption of cloud technologies.
